On March 27, the College recognised 44 residents who achieved academic excellence in the Semester 2, 2023 study period.

The residents took the stage at an Academic Awards Formal Dinner attended by the College Residents, Academic Guides, Staff, and Esteemed Guests. The College announced the recipients of the coveted Knox Scholarship Awards and recognised residents who earned Academic Excellence awards by achieving a High-Distinction average. The full list of recipients is at the bottom of this article.

We were honoured to have Prof Chris Thompson, Director of Education for the Biomedical Discovery Institute at Monash University, as our keynote speaker. Chris shared some valuable insights about resilience and leaning on your community when things are not going your way, a critical message to share on an evening highlighting the achievements and commitment of our residents. We also welcomed Prof Bryan Horrigan and Prof Sarah McDonald from Monash University to present the awards.

The Knox Scholarships are awarded in memory of Cardinal James Robert Knox, Archbishop of Melbourne between 1967 and 1974, who blessed and laid the foundation stone at Mannix College on Thursday, May 23, 1968. Knox Scholarships were awarded to the highest-performing resident in each faculty and included a cash prize of $750 provided by the Catholic Archdiocese of Melbourne.

The College is pleased to support and recognise those residents who have demonstrated academic excellence and notes how competitive these awards are, especially given the high quality of Mannix students.

The College is committed to offering residents a robust academic program to assist them in achieving their academic goals. Every Tuesday evening of the Semester, The College delivers an in-person academic workshop and subject-specific support from our Academic Guides and Mentors team. This provides a crucial bridge between the College and the learning support offered by Monash University. 

The College congratulates all students on their academic efforts and progress.
